the ratio of isabellas money to shanes money is 3:11. If isabella has $33, how much money do Shane and Isabella have together?

[tex] \frac{3}{11} = \frac{33}{n} [/tex]

Since 3 x 11 = 33 we can multiply the denomiator (11) by 11 and get 121
So Shane has $121

Together they have $121 + $33 or $154.00
